Web17 mrt. 2024 · Households are eligible for the ACP if they earn less than 200 percent of the federal poverty line or participate in qualifying programs. Estimates suggest that somewhere between 52 and 55 million U.S. households are eligible for the program. By the end of 2024, about 28% of eligible households (or 15.4 million) had enrolled. WebAffordable Connectivity Program provides a $30/mo. credit (or up to $75/mo. for Tribal Lands) towards broadband service for qualified households. WebWhat is the Affordable Connectivity Program? The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P) is a U.S. government program run by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) program to help low-income households pay for internet service and connected devices like a laptop or tablet.. You are likely eligible if your household’s income is below 200% of … WebThe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P) service is a federal benefit program only available to individuals who participate in a qualifying government program or who are eligible based on their household income. Only one benefit per household is allowed; a household is not permitted to receive ACP benefits from multiple providers.
